What is a picking and packing job?

Picking and packing jobs involve selecting items from a warehouse or storage area based on customer orders (picking) and then preparing those items for shipment by packing them securely (packing). These roles are essential in the supply chain and are commonly found in warehouses, distribution centers, and retail fulfillment centers. Workers use equipment such as scanners, carts, and packing materials to ensure accuracy and efficiency. Attention to detail and the ability to work quickly are important skills for these jobs.

What are some common challenges faced in a picking and packing role, and how can they be managed?

A common challenge in Picking and Packing roles is maintaining accuracy and speed under time pressure, especially during peak seasons. Workers may also encounter repetitive motion or physical fatigue from prolonged standing and lifting. To manage these, companies often provide ergonomic tools, clear workflow instructions, and regular breaks. Additionally, teamwork and communication with supervisors help address issues quickly and keep operations running smoothly.

What is the difference between Picking And Packing v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ectPicking And PackingWarehouse Associate
Primary DutiesSelecting items from inventory and packing them for shipmentGeneral warehouse tasks including receiving, storing, and organizing inventory
Skills & CertificationsAttention to detail, basic forklift or equipment certifications often preferredInventory management, forklift operation, safety training
Work EnvironmentWarehouse, distribution centers, fulfillment centersWarehouse, storage facilities, distribution centers
Industry UsageCommon in e-commerce, retail, logisticsBroadly used across various industries requiring warehouse work

Picking And Packing focuses specifically on selecting items and preparing shipments, while Warehouse Associate covers a wider range of warehouse tasks including inventory management and general organization. Both roles are essential in logistics and distribution, often overlapping but with distinct primary responsibilities.

Job description

Distribution Associate I (Day Shift)

As directed by the supervisor and/or group leader, perform functions to fulfill orders for shipment to customers. This may include but is not limited to customer service support, replenishment, cycle counting, picking, packing, and manifesting. Employee may be trained in any or all of the required disciplines depending on business needs. Employee must work all assigned hours and may also be required to perform other duties as directed by the supervisor and/or group leader.

Follow prioritized assignments, provide customer service support, and ensure the completion of order fulfillment (picking, packing, manifesting), maintain inventory through putaway, breakdowns, replenishment, and cycle count in a timely manner, meeting or exceeding productivity and quality standards. Cabinet building - perform physical picking, receiving, building, packing, and shipping of fitset kits according to SOPs and as prioritized. Must meet or exceed productivity and quality standards. Work area cleaning - Clean assigned work area on a daily basis including sweeping, dusting, trash/box disposal, general straightening, etc. Error Review- as necessary, perform review and correction of unfulfilled orders having discrepancies to record and assign any errors. Perform daily work assignments including, but not limited to, order fulfillment and proper maintenance of inventory in Lynchburg. Follow all security, safety, and quality standards. Must maintain successful work relationships with Quality, Inventory Control, and Management.

High School Diploma or equivalent. Six months of distribution or warehouse experience and basic PC knowledge. Familiar with RF Technology and forklift experience a plus.
